​神影録とは
About ShineiRoku

古くから日本では山や川、風などの自然に神が宿っていた。遠い昔、人間の自然破壊により一部の神は居場所や力を失い、異形化し「神影」と呼ばれた。神影はその恐ろしい姿ゆえに人々に討ち払われ、姿を消した。その出来事は歴史の中で語り手を失い、民話にも伝承にも残らず、わずかに古文書の一部ににその記録があるのみで人々の記憶からほとんど消え去ってしまった。

だが近年山間部や人里近くで古い記録に残る神影に似た未確認の存在が目撃されている。彼らが何のために現れ、どのような意図を持つのかは分かっていない。忘れられた神の嘆きの姿なのか、自然が人間に向けた怒りの化身なのか。その声を読み解くための記録こそが『神影録』である。

In ancient Japan, it was believed that gods resided within nature—mountains, rivers, the wind, and more. Long ago, the destruction of nature by humans caused some of these gods to lose their places and their powers. Twisted and transformed, they became known as Shinei. Due to their terrifying appearance, they were driven away by humans and eventually vanished. Over time, the events surrounding them faded from history—unspoken by storytellers, absent from folklore and tradition. Only fragments in old manuscripts remain, and the memories of Shinei have nearly disappeared from the minds of people.Yet in recent years, sightings of mysterious beings resembling the ancient Shinei have been reported in remote mountains and even near human settlements. No one knows why they appear or what their intentions may be. Are they the sorrowful forms of forgotten gods? Or incarnations of nature’s wrath toward humanity?
The record meant to decipher their voices and truths is the “ShineiRoku.”
